Transaction 9985036ef6614c9f93cc11ee61592776d745ec873356cae7448278324006cf95
1 Input
1 Output
-
9985036ef6614c9f93cc11ee61592776d745ec873356cae7448278324006cf95:0
- value
- 602195
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8749fbae9350059a31d2db1006159c4cc6da5b0c OP_EQUAL
- address
- 3E2MmswJhJTHhiRUP5cSzkAfTC7Hpe8mLJ